Dental Caries Clinical Trial
Official title:
Radiographic Contrast To Differentiate Cavitated From Non-cavitated Tooth Decay

The proposed test is intended to enable dentists to differentiate between cavitated and non-cavitated tooth decay in the areas where teeth are in contact (interproximal surfaces). In these areas, dentists cannot visually inspect for caries, and currently bitewing X-rays (BWs) only correctly detect the presence of enamel decay 15-25% of the time. This low sensitivity can lead to late treatment resulting in unnecessarily large fillings, crowns, pain, root canals, and possible later loss of teeth.

| Eligibility |
Inclusion Criteria: - Must have a minimum of 2 adjacent teeth so that interproximal surfaces of interest are in contact and hidden from direct visual examination. The occlusal plane plane should be normal so that the interproximal contact regions are normal. English or Spanish speaker. Exclusion Criteria: - Pregnant women. A person who has participated in a similar study involving dental radiography within the last 12 months. Fillings must not be present in the regions of interest. |

| Primary | Number of cavitated versus non-cavitated caries lesions in 116 tooth surfaces. | The PI will perform the clinical application of the sodium iodide and radiograph the subject. A control radiograph will be taken of tooth crowns before the application of the contrast. Immediately after the contrast application another radiograph will be exposed. If caries is present a lucency will be seen in the control The test radiograph will show either contrast on the tooth surface (non-cavitated) or below the surface (caviiatetd). Rubber impressions will be made of the tooth surfaces and scanned with a laser to provide a 3D replica which will be the gold standard for presence or absence of cavitation. At a later date 3 independent dentists will be provided with blinded radiographs in a randomized order to report the presence or absence of cavitated cries lesions. | Immediately after application of sodium iodide | No |
